Hino 300 trucks: Inappropriate bolt tightening during spare tyre carrier installation

CountryNew Zealand
CategoryAutomotive
Published2025-04-29
Models affected300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300, 300
Model year2023-2024
DefectHino Motors has advised that due to an inappropriate method of bolt tightening during the installation of the spare tyre carrier, the bolt torque may not be adequate. If the vehicle continues to operate with this condition the bolts may loosen through vibration.
RemedyContact your nearest TruckStops Dealer or authorised Hino Service Dealer to have the bolt torque checked. Enquiries can be made on 0800367446_x000D_ http://truckstops.co.nz/locations/branches
